# Approvals: Brushfire Stale-Branch Cleanup Bot

Brushfire deletes branches with no commits in 90 days, excluding protected and release branches. Any change to its deletion rules, exclusion list, or dry-run defaults requires two approvals: one from the owning team and one from repository administration. Emergency pauses may be approved by a single reviewer but must be ratified within one business day. Deletion logs are retained for six months and are auditable on request. Final sign-off authority rests with the person named below.

account owner for bawip-tahag: Raleth Quenok

- [ ] **Step 7: Breaker override escrow.** After sealing the signing keys for the Tallgrove upstream API circuit breaker, confirm the support team can force the breaker open during a full outage. The override bundle lives in the sealed escrow drawer and is useless without its unlock phrase. Two ceremony witnesses must initial this step before proceeding. The escrow bundle is decrypted with the recovery passphrase that follows.

vault phrase of kahip-kahop = holath-quenmir

## Configuration

Digestly batches user notifications into a single email per cycle. Set DIGEST_CRON to control the schedule (default: hourly). DIGEST_MAX_ITEMS caps entries per email. Support can adjust both without a redeploy; changes apply next cycle. The outbound mail relay requires an auth credential. Add this line to the service's env file.

vault entry, yahif-yajep: COURIER_KEY29=b802bdf8034096b65a51c6ba5abe2

Ticket OPS-2291. Postmortem doc for the stale-cache bug (catalog reads served 40-minute-old prices) is stuck in the Kestrelgate vault; auto-unseal failed after last night's key rotation. On-call needs the doc before the review at 14:00. Three unseal attempts already burned — do not retry blindly or it hard-locks for 24h. Use manual recovery instead: open the vault CLI, select manual unseal, and enter the recovery passphrase noted below.

recovery phrase for bajop-tahaf: kasael-istmir-kaseth-oliwyn-aldax-pelael-ralius